- The distance between Clinton, Ia, Usa and Waingawa, New Zealand is approximately 13,209 km or 8,208 mi.
- To reach Clinton, Ia in this distance one would set out from Waingawa bearing 57.7°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Clinton, Ia bearing 59.2° or ENE .
- Clinton, Ia has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a) whereas Waingawa has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Clinton, Ia is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Waingawa is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ome.
- The average annual temperature is 2.4 °C (4.3°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.2 °C (36.4°F) more in Clinton, Ia.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 58.4 mm (2.3 in) less which is equivalent to 58.4 l/m² (1.43 US gal/ft²) or 584,000 l/ha (62,433 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0.4° lower in Clinton, Ia than in Waingawa.
